Syria Evacuates IS-Linked Camp Amid Tensions

Syrian government officials acknowledged widespread escapes from the al-Hol camp, which housed tens of thousands of women and children linked to ISIS, after the government took control of the site in January. According to a Syrian government official who spoke to Sky News, the camp in northeastern Syria is now largely emptied due to these escapes.

Government forces captured the camp from the Kurdish-led Syrian Democratic Forces (SDF) last month, and have begun evacuating the remaining residents, according to Euronews. Al-Hol, located in the northeastern Hasakeh province, was Syria's largest camp housing family members of suspected ISIS militants. The camp had been largely emptied by escapes after the Syrian government took control, according to a Sky News report.

Tesla Robotaxis Crash 4x More in Austin
AI Insights1h ago

Tesla Robotaxis Crash 4x More in Austin

Drawing from multiple news reports, Tesla's Robotaxi fleet in Austin, Texas, has experienced five new crashes in December 2025 and January 2026, bringing the total to 14 incidents since its June 2025 launch, with one earlier crash upgraded to include a hospitalization. These incidents, involving Model Y vehicles, include collisions with stationary objects, other vehicles, and a bus, while Tesla continues to redact detailed narratives, unlike other automated driving system operators.
